Doug Chand ler made a good point ab out Las Vegas las t A helping hand A fte r th e d irt tr ack ra ce held in Lodi, California, on July 10, I felt com pe lled to write to Cycle News to share a moment The Coombs respond In response to M ickael Pichon' s recen t letter s co ncerning th e inciden ts at th e H igh Point Nationals that led to his fine, proba tio n and su bsequen t termin at io n by Ho nda, I wou ld lik e to point so methi ng o ut: At no tim e does Mickael mention th e fact th at he punched a race officia l thr ee times in the back of th e head . This alone, withou t th e bizarre actions of his fat he r th at afternoon, mer its the $3000 fine placed on him . . Secondly, G erry Wago ner's le tt e r h e re asser ting that P ic hon 's ac tions were th e result of "A MA- induced agitation " is no t only w rong but ignorant. Th e AMA did not even talk to Pich on until afte r he struck N PG site m anager Joh n Ayers , w ho h ad go ne to t h e Hond a pi ts to tr y to so rt th is out. Blaming the A MA a n d tra ck o ff icia ls fo r a nything in this w hole m atter is like blaming th e ba s ketball coa ch for the pl ayer cho ki ng him. Th is was not a "p arking in cident," as Mickael Pichon ref erred to it , but rather a n unw arranted physical assau lt on a man with hi s ba ck turn ed . The fin e m ay s ee m excess ive when co mpared to th e dollar va lu es pl ac ed o n pa st tr ansgressi ons in AMA m ot ocro ss and su percross, but th en again, no one in the past e ve r punch ed o u t an official.
